A well-established independent (private) preparatory school in the Borough of Hillingdon is seeking to appoint a creative and nurturing EYFS Teacher to join their Early Years team from September 2026. This is an excellent opportunity for a passionate early years practitioner who is confident delivering high-quality provision within a supportive, structured, and child-focused independent school setting. The role would suit someone who is enthusiastic about giving children the strongest possible start to their education in a calm and inspiring environment.

About the School

This is a respected independent preparatory school catering for children aged 3-11, with a strong local reputation for its warm atmosphere, high expectations, and commitment to developing the whole child. Class sizes are intentionally small, allowing for individual attention and strong relationships between staff and pupils.

The school offers:

  • Small class sizes with excellent adult-to-child ratios in EYFS
  • A well-resourced Early Years environment with both indoor and outdoor continuous provision
  • A strong emphasis on play-based, experiential learning alongside structured phonics and early numeracy
  • A supportive leadership team with a clear focus on staff wellbeing and professional development
  • High levels of parental engagement and a strong sense of community
  • Specialist teaching in areas such as music, PE, and languages from Early Years onwards
  • A calm, well-maintained campus with dedicated EYFS classrooms and outdoor learning spaces

The school places a strong emphasis on combining academic foundations with creativity, independence, and confidence-building from the earliest stages.

The Role

The successful candidate will take responsibility for delivering high-quality EYFS provision, working closely with the Early Years team and senior leadership.

Key responsibilities include:

  • Planning and delivering engaging EYFS learning experiences in line with the EYFS Framework
  • Creating a stimulating, language-rich, and inclusive classroom environment
  • Supporting children's personal, social, emotional, and academic development
  • Observing, assessing, and recording progress accurately using EYFS profiles
  • Leading early phonics, literacy, and numeracy learning
  • Building strong relationships with pupils, parents, and colleagues
  • Working collaboratively with teaching assistants and EYFS staff to enhance provision

The school is looking for someone who can combine structure and high expectations with creativity, warmth, and flexibility.

The Ideal Candidate

The school would welcome applications from teachers who:

  • Hold UK Qualified Teacher Status (QTS)
  • Have experience working within EYFS (independent school experience is desirable but not essential)
  • Have a strong understanding of early childhood development and play-based learning
  • Are confident delivering early phonics and foundational maths
  • Bring a nurturing, patient, and reflective approach to teaching
  • Work effectively as part of a collaborative and supportive team
  • Are committed to high standards and continuous improvement

This position would suit an experienced EYFS teacher or a confident Early Career Teacher with strong early years training and placements.

This is a full-time, permanent position starting September 2026.
